我已经使用bower将lodash
安装到我的angularjs应用程序:
bower install --save lodash
bower.json相应更新:
{
"name": "my-app",
"version": "0.0.0",
"dependencies": {
"lodash": "^4.11.2",
"angular": "~1.4.0",
"json3": "~3.2.4",
"jquery": "~1.10.0",
"sass-bootstrap": "~3.0.0",
"es5-shim": "~2.1.0",
"angular-resource": "~1.4.0",
"angular-cookies": "~1.4.0",
"angular-sanitize": "~1.4.0",
"angular-route": "~1.4.0",
"angular-ui": "~0.4.0"
},
"devDependencies": {
"angular-mocks": "~1.4.0",
"angular-scenario": "~1.4.0"
}
}
bower_components
目录中添加了一个lodash
目录,我已经运行了grunt server
。但是,lodash的<script>
标签没有添加到index.html
。
安装了bower后,如何将lodash
添加到我的应用程序中?FWIW,我已经成功地安装了其他前端组件,但没有遇到这个问题,所以要么我正在做一些不同的事情,要么我的环境已经改变。
我不确定如何调查这个问题。
您需要手动完成或使用Grunt Wiredep任务。如果你的应用程序已经配置了wiredep任务,那么只需运行grunt wiredep